Door makeover

Orgionally the door was quite basic, it had a paint job but was a pretty basic one so it was time to jazz them up a bit to bring back character.

 

20220204_130245.jpg

Materials

Paint is Brighton Mist and Trimming Mouldings selected from bunnings of course.
